Output 7b5d8f4ce5225695a0c7163cbc673eb3252a14d27684515a7944a3a385e5735e:1

value
1705020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23754568dc902c3df9fb1b816fb3b52f04d8a6a5 OP_EQUAL
address
34vW4Q63gXWXrmAsHdrFWeCniwDAbFJzGs
transaction
7b5d8f4ce5225695a0c7163cbc673eb3252a14d27684515a7944a3a385e5735e
spent
true